I am a Prostate Cancer Survivor
I had to jump off the buckboard on our shared journey for recovery from and prevention of sexual abuse of children.
My doctors told me I had prostate cancer and if I wanted to continue the journey I had to address the cancer. The urology department of the Minneapolis VA Hospital supported by multiple PSA tests and a prostate biopsy confirmed the cancer diagnosis and then convinced my procrastinating mind to get off the buckboard with statements like: “You will not be protecting children in the near future if you don’t take care of yourself now !”
Now, the doctors are telling me I kicked the shit out of the Grim Reaper ! The only current bad news is that I cannot run fast enough to catch up with the team of buckboards filled with advocates on the recovery from sexual abuse and child protection journey.
